Terraced two-bay two-storey house, c.1840, retaining early fenestration. Reroofed, c.1990. One of a terrace of nine. Pitched (shared) roof with replacement artificial slate, c.1990, clay ridge tiles, rendered (shared) chimney stacks, and cast-iron rainwater goods on rendered eaves. Painted rendered walls. Square-headed window openings with stone sills, and 6/6 timber sash windows. Square-headed door opening in shallow segmental-headed recess with replacement glazed timber panelled door, c.1990. Road fronted with raised concrete flagged footpath to front having sections of wrought iron railings and flights of steps.
This house, built as part of a group of nine terraced houses of identical appearance, is an attractive, small-scale composition that has been well maintained, retaining its original form together with important early salient features and materials. The house, together with the remainder of the terrace (22501869/WD-5632-21-888), forms part of an attractive streetscape in Francis Street, adhering to the topography of the sloping site through the use of a sloping roofline.
